Course Outline
Notion Fundamentals and Database Concepts
- An overview of Notion blocks, pages, and workspaces
- Understanding properties, records, and foundational relations
- Design principles for building scalable Notion databases
Designing Relational Databases in Notion
- Creating linked databases and defining relations
- Utilizing rollups to surface aggregated information
- Selecting appropriate property types and schema design patterns
Building Views and Interactive Dashboards
- Creating tables, Kanban, calendar, gallery, and timeline views
- Applying filters, sorts, and groupings to create insight-driven views
- Combining linked views to form unified dashboards
Data Import, Export, and Sync Strategies
- Importing CSV files and migrating spreadsheets into Notion
- Using integrations and connectors for ongoing synchronizations
- Best practices for preserving data integrity during transfers
Formulas, Rollups, and Automations
- Writing Notion formulas for calculated properties
- Advanced rollup patterns for metrics and KPIs
- Automating routine updates with Notion integrations and tools
Designing Dashboards for Goals and Project Tracking
- Mapping project workflows to relational tables and views
- Creating goal-tracking dashboards with progress indicators
- Implementing review and reporting workflows for stakeholders
Analytics and Reporting Techniques
- Designing metric-driven pages and summary tiles
- Exporting curated data for external analysis
- Using rollups and formulas to create lightweight analytics
Collaboration, Permissions, and Governance
- Managing workspace permissions and sharing strategies
- Template design and governance for consistent usage
- Maintaining and refactoring databases as needs evolve
Summary and Next Steps
